|
在前端中,有一個很重要的概念就是事件。我對于事件的理解就是使用者對瀏覽器進行的一個動作,或者說一個操作。
本文會介紹很多與事件有關的東西,雖然我的出發點有那么點一網打盡的意思m不過也難以蓋全,所以就把最常用,最基本也相對重要的內容拿出來記錄一下。
Javascript綁定事件的方式
傳統的事件綁定
因為各種歷史原因,事件的綁定在不同的瀏覽器總是有不同的寫法,當然現在可能大多數人都已經習慣于jQuery的事件綁定,而不清楚Javascript的原生事件綁定是什么樣子。
非常傳統的事件的綁定方式,是在一個元素上直接綁定方法,element.onclick = function(e){}
<body> <input type="button" id="bt" name="bt button" value="this is a button"> <script> var bt = document.getElementById("bt"); bt.onclick = function(e){ alert("this is a alert"); alert(e.currentTarget.name); } </script> </body>
it知識庫:瀏覽器中關于事件的那點事兒,轉載需保留來源!
鄭重聲明:本文版權歸原作者所有,轉載文章僅為傳播更多信息之目的,如作者信息標記有誤,請第一時間聯系我們修改或刪除,多謝。